En este tutorial explicaremos la guía paso a paso para convertir SVG a PNG usando C#. También desarrollaremos un ejemplo para la función SVG a PNG C# siguiendo los pasos definidos en esta publicación. La transformación de documentos es un proceso simple que solo requiere unas pocas líneas de código. Las instrucciones completas y el código de muestra se pueden ver a continuación.
Pasos para convertir SVG a PNG usando C#
- Instale GroupDocs.Conversion for .NET desde el administrador de paquetes NuGet en la aplicación .NET
- Incluya el espacio de nombres GroupDocs.Conversion para realizar la conversión de documentos de formato SVG a PNG
- Cree una instancia de la clase Converter y pase el archivo SVG a su constructor
- Inicialice la clase ImageConvertOptions y defina las opciones de conversión para el archivo PNG de salida
- Invoque el método Convert de la clase Converter, pásele el nombre del archivo PNG de salida y ImageConvertOptions.
Estas instrucciones describen todo el flujo de trabajo de conversión de documentos de SVG a PNG. Con la ayuda de los puntos mencionados anteriormente, puede construir fácil y rápidamente la capacidad C# SVG a PNG. Puede comenzar descargando el paquete necesario e incluyendo una referencia a él en su código. En los próximos pasos, cargue el archivo SVG de origen y configure las opciones de conversión para el archivo PNG de salida. Finalmente, guarde el archivo PNG generado en el disco llamando a la función Convertir.
Código para convertir SVG a PNG usando C#
El ejemplo anterior demuestra cómo implementar la función C# convertir SVG a PNG siguiendo las instrucciones de la sección anterior. Solo hemos consumido algunas llamadas a la API para realizar la conversión de documentos sin una herramienta de terceros. También puede convertir SVG a muchos otros formatos de documentos, incluidos JPG, GIF, WEBP, PPSM, PSD, CSV y muchos más.
Hemos discutido el proceso de conversión de documentos para transformar el formato SVG a PNG y hemos creado un código de muestra en esta publicación. En nuestro tutorial anterior, analizamos cómo convertir HTML a RTF en C#; compruébalo para obtener más información.